8. Powered by AWS Logo Formatting Requirements.

(a) No Modification. We will make the Powered by AWS Logo image available to you from the AWS Co-Marketing Tools. You may not remove, distort or modify any element of the Powered by AWS Logo; however, you may convert the Powered by AWS Logo file format itself (or the file format of any other logo we may make available to you), for ease of use.

(b) Color. The Powered by AWS Logo may be represented in the following formats: FULL COLOR (i) light backgrounds—squid ink type with Amazon Orange smile; (ii) dark backgrounds— white type with Amazon Orange smile; or for single-color applications; SINGLE COLOR (iii) light backgrounds—Squid Ink type with Squid Ink smile (preferred); GRAYSCALE (iv) light backgrounds—Black type with Black smile; (v) dark backgrounds— white type with white smile. No alternate color representation or combination will be acceptable.

When in FULL COLOR:
The graphic element (smile) must be in Amazon Orange
HEX: #FF9900
RGB: 255—153—0
CMYK: 0—45—95—0
PMS: COATED 1375 C
UNCOATED 137 U

The type must be in Squid Ink
HEX: #232F3E
RGB: 35—47—62
CMYK: 53—36—0—86
PMS: COATED 432 C

When in SINGLE COLOR:

Light Backgrounds: The graphic element (smile) and type must be in Squid Ink
HEX: #232F3E
RGB: 35—47—62
CMYK: 53—36—0—86
PMS: COATED 432 C

When in GRAYSCALE:

Light Backgrounds: The graphic element (smile) and type must be in Black
HEX: #000000
RGB: 0—0—0
CMYK: 0—0—0—100
PMS: Black

Dark Backgrounds: The graphic element (smile) and type must be in White
HEX: #FFFFFF
RGB: 255—255—255
CMYK: 0—0—0—0
PMS: White

(c) Spacing. The Powered by AWS Logo must appear by itself in a clearly visible location, with reasonable spacing (at least the height of the Powered by AWS Logo) between each side of the logo and other graphic or textual elements.

(d) Size. The Powered by AWS Logo, as shown in Section 2, must be displayed at a sufficient size to ensure that the type is reasonably legible.

9. Permissible Uses of the AWS Marks. Except as permitted in Section 3 and as otherwise expressly permitted by us in writing, you may only use the AWS Marks: (i) in a relational phrase using “for” or one of the equivalent naming conventions listed below; or (ii) to the right of the top-level domain name (e.g., ”.com”, ”.net”, ”.uk”) in a URL.

  • Relational Phrases.
    Example of Permissible Use:
    [Your Application] for EC2
    Equivalents:
    You may replace “for” in this example with any of the following, so long as the term you use is accurate when used with the AWS Marks: “for use with”; “with”; “compatible with”; “works with”; “powered by”; “built on”; “built with”; “developed on”; “developed with.”
    You may replace “EC2” in this example with any of the AWS Marks, so long as your use of the AWS Marks is accurate.
  • URLs.
    Example of Permissible Use:
    www.YourDomainName.com/aws
    Equivalents:
    You may replace “aws” in this example with any of the AWS Marks, so long as your usage of the AWS Marks is accurate.

10. Hyperlinking. You may link AWS Marks to http://aws.amazon.com or to an AWS detail page for a Service used by Your Content. If you link to a Service detail page, you must link to the primary URL for the Service (e.g., the primary URL for Amazon Elastic Compute Cloud (Amazon EC2) is http://aws.amazon.com/ec2). You may open the URL in a new browser window. You may not link the AWS Marks to any other website. You may not frame or mirror any of our website pages.

11. No Combination. You may not hyphenate, combine or abbreviate the AWS Marks. You may not incorporate the AWS Marks into the names of your organization, products, or services, or into your trademarks or logos. This prohibition includes the use of the AWS Marks in a URL to the left of the top-level domain name. For example, domains and subdomains such as “alexaaa.mydomain.com”, “mymechanicalturk.net” or “EC2plus2.com” are expressly prohibited.
